RETRY MECHANISM FOR LOW ENERGY COMMUNICATIONS - A simplified explanation of the abstract

This abstract first appeared for US patent application 20240275525 titled 'RETRY MECHANISM FOR LOW ENERGY COMMUNICATIONS

Simplified Explanation: The patent application describes a retry technique that reduces redundant transmit streams and retransmissions in scenarios where multiple devices are listening to the same audio stream. This technique aims to decrease power consumption and airtime usage by optimizing data communication between a source device and multiple sink devices.

  • **Key Features and Innovation:**
   - Utilizes a hybrid isochronous group to communicate data, consisting of broadcast isochronous streams and connected isochronous streams.
   - Broadcast isochronous streams transmit data from the source device to multiple sink devices.
   - Connected isochronous streams send acknowledgements of receiving the data back to the source device.

Original Abstract Submitted

a retry technique reduces or eliminates redundant transmit streams and redundant retransmissions when multiple devices are listening to the same audio stream. the retry techniques reduce power consumption and reduce airtime usage. the retry technique includes communicating data using a hybrid isochronous group including a plurality of broadcast isochronous streams from a source device to a plurality of sink devices. the hybrid isochronous group includes, for each broadcast isochronous stream, a group of connected isochronous streams including a connected isochronous stream to the source device from each of the plurality of sink devices. the broadcast isochronous streams communicate the data and the connected isochronous streams communicate acknowledgements of receiving the data.
